Verdict

Raleigh, NC offers better overall compensation for medical assistants, winning 4 out of 4 metrics compared to Thomasville.

The salary gap between Raleigh and Thomasville is $3,627 (8.09%). Raleigh's median is +1.03% compared to the US national median of $47,961.

Salary Range Comparison

The full salary range (10th to 90th percentile) in Raleigh spans $19,629,Thomasville spans $22,907. Thomasville has a wider pay range, suggesting more variation in pay between entry-level and experienced medical assistants.

Cost-of-Living Adjusted Comparison

After cost-of-living adjustment, Raleigh ($49,364 effective) pays 3.07% more than Thomasville ($47,892 effective).

Historical Salary Growth Comparison

Based on BLS OEWS metropolitan area data, medical assistant salaries in Raleigh grew 32.5% from 2019 to 2025, compared to 22.4% growth in Thomasville over the same period.

Methodology & Data Source

All salary figures are 2026 projections based on BLS OEWS May 2025 data. A 4.97% CAGR (derived from 6-year national BLS trends) was applied to estimate current compensation. Cost-of-living adjustments use BEA Regional Price Parity data. Actual salaries vary by employer, certifications, and experience.
